When main power is turned on by turning the main
power switch (MP) to the ON position, the power up
screen will be displayed until communication and
initialization is complete.
Then the power key icon screen will display until the
ADM power on/off button (A)
is pressed for the
rst time after system power-up.
To begin using the ADM, the machine must be active.
To verify the machine is active, verify that the System
Status Indicator Light (B) is illuminated green, see
Advanced Display Module (ADM), page 22. If the
System Status Indicator Light is not green, press
the ADM Power On/Off (A) button
. The System
Status Indicator Light will illuminate yellow if the
machine is disabled.
Perform the following tasks to fully setup your system.
1. Set pressure values for the Pressure Imbalance
Alarm to activate. See System Screen 1, page 36.
2. Enter, enable, or disable recipes. See
Recipes Screen, page 37.
3. Set general system settings. See
Advanced Screen 1 General, page 35.
4. Set units of measure. See
Advanced Screen 2 Units, page 35.
5. Set USB settings. See
Advanced Screen 3— USB, page 35.
6. Set target temperatures and pressure. See
Targets, page 39.
7. Set component A and component B supply
levels. See Maintenance, page 40.
